Join us this summer as the National Air and Space Museum presents a series of concerts in the Museum in Washington, DC. Presented by various ensembles from the renowned US Air Force Band and the US Navy Band, the concerts will feature vocal and instrumental selections from a variety of musical genres including big band, jazz, popular, patriotic, and classical. These world-class musicians, who have performed throughout the United States and the world, are sure to both entertain and inspire you.
Performances will begin at 11 am, 12 pm, 1 pm and 2 pm. Each concert will last 20 minutes.
